Portuguese law provides that gametes donors (for spermatozoa and oocytes) are altruistic volunteers. Before being admitted as donors to Ferticentro, donor candidates are subject to a rigorous process of evaluation of their health and fertility, and those who are carriers of genetic disease or have a family history of this type of problem are excluded.
Ferticentro has a sperm bank and a bank of oocytes of its own, in which there are hundreds of samples of donors of different ethnic origins. This way, it is possible to assign a donor with physical characteristics as close as possible to those of the couple or receiving woman.
At Ferticentro we also work with international gametes banks with we liaise in situations where the patients have physical characteristics that are not so prevailent in the Portuguese population.
